Reconstruction:Proto-West Germanic/þrot
Proto-West Germanic
Etymology
From Proto-Germanic *þrutą.
Noun
*þrot n
Inflection
| Neuter a-stem | ||
|---|---|---|
| Singular | ||
| Nominative | *þrot | |
| Genitive | *þrotas | |
| Singular | Plural | |
| Nominative | *þrot | *þrotu |
| Accusative | *þrot | *þrotu |
| Genitive | *þrotas | *þrotō |
| Dative | *þrotē | *þrotum |
| Instrumental | *þrotu | *þrotum |
Derived terms
Descendants
- Old English: þrot
- Old Saxon: *throt
- ⇒ Old Saxon: farthrot
